Chelsea’s Head Coach Enzo Maresca Faces Emotional Return to Greece
Chelsea’s upcoming match against Panathinaikos in the Conference League on Thursday holds special significance for head coach Enzo Maresca. The trip to Greece brings back bittersweet memories for the former player turned coach.
A Journey Full of Emotions
Enzo Maresca, who once donned the jersey of Greek giants Olympiacos, is no stranger to the country’s footballing scene. His time in Greece was marked by triumphs and setbacks, but it was a period that shaped him both personally and professionally. However, what makes this return to Greece particularly poignant for Maresca is the memory of a lost friend and teammate.
Maresca spent several successful seasons at Sevilla, where he formed a close bond with a fellow player who tragically passed away. The loss of his friend left a void in Maresca’s life, making his return to Greece a somber and emotional experience.
